Protein of Animal Origin vs. Protein of Plant Origin
What's the Difference?
Protein of animal origin typically contains all nine essential amino acids that the human body needs to function properly, making it a complete protein source. Animal proteins are also easily digestible and have high bioavailability, meaning the body can easily absorb and utilize the protein. On the other hand, protein of plant origin may not always contain all essential amino acids, making it important for vegetarians and vegans to consume a variety of plant-based protein sources to ensure they are getting all the necessary nutrients. Plant proteins also tend to be lower in saturated fats and cholesterol compared to animal proteins, making them a healthier option for those looking to reduce their intake of these substances.

Further Detail
Introduction
Protein is an essential macronutrient that plays a crucial role in the growth, repair, and maintenance of tissues in the human body. It is made up of amino acids, which are often referred to as the building blocks of protein. While both animal and plant-based sources of protein are important for a balanced diet, there are some key differences between the two in terms of their nutritional composition and health implications.
Nutritional Composition
Protein from animal sources, such as meat, poultry, fish, eggs, and dairy products, is considered a complete protein because it contains all nine essential amino acids that the body cannot produce on its own. These essential amino acids are important for various bodily functions, including muscle building and repair. On the other hand, plant-based sources of protein, such as beans, lentils, nuts, seeds, and whole grains, are often considered incomplete proteins because they may lack one or more essential amino acids. However, by combining different plant-based protein sources, individuals can still obtain all the essential amino acids needed for optimal health.
Digestibility
Protein from animal sources is generally more easily digestible than protein from plant sources. This is because animal proteins are structurally similar to human proteins, making them easier for the body to break down and absorb. In contrast, plant proteins may contain anti-nutrients, such as phytates and lectins, which can interfere with the absorption of nutrients in the gut. Additionally, some plant proteins, such as those found in beans and legumes, may cause digestive discomfort in some individuals due to their high fiber content.

Environmental Impact
One of the key differences between animal and plant-based sources of protein is their environmental impact. Animal agriculture is a major contributor to greenhouse gas emissions, deforestation, and water pollution. The production of animal-based protein also requires more resources, such as land, water, and feed, compared to plant-based protein sources. In contrast, plant-based protein production has a lower environmental footprint, making it a more sustainable choice for individuals concerned about the impact of their diet on the planet.
Health Implications
Research has shown that a diet high in animal-based protein may be associated with an increased risk of chronic diseases, such as heart disease, diabetes, and certain types of cancer. This is thought to be due to the higher saturated fat and cholesterol content of animal proteins. On the other hand, plant-based sources of protein have been linked to a lower risk of chronic diseases and may offer protective benefits against certain health conditions. Additionally, plant-based diets are often higher in fiber, vitamins, minerals, and antioxidants, which can further promote overall health and well-being.
